Performance

Whether you're driving a new VW Atlas in Greensboro NC or a new VW Atlas Cross Sport near Greensboro, there won't be much of a difference in terms of power between the two. Both of these SUVs have the following features:

  • A 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ine is standard, producing up to 235 horsepower and 258 pound-feet of torque.
  • The engine is a 3.6-liter V6 with 276 horsepower and 266 pound-feet of torque.
  • The capacity to pull up to 5,000 pounds
  • A 4MOTION® with Active Control system is available, with four all-wheel drive modes.

To keep the engine and other components in good working order, be sure to treat your car to Volkswagen service Greensboro.

Volkswagen Greensboro 2021 Atlas and Atlas Cross Sport

Interior Space

The interiors of the Atlas and Atlas Cross Sport are similar, with a variety of standard and optional features. The most notable difference is the SUV's size.

  • Volkswagen Atlas Interior Capacity - Seats up to seven people and has up to 96.8 cubic feet of luggage space.
  • VW Atlas Cross Sport Interior Capacity - Seats up to five people without a third row and has 77.8 cubic feet of luggage space.

As you can see, the Atlas is ideal for bigger families or people who appreciate having more room to stretch out. The Atlas Cross Sport is ideal for smaller families and is more maneuverable on Greensboro NC streets.

The engine control unit (ECU) is an electronic module that regulates the performance of your engine. If your vehicle's ECU is malfunctioning, it might create a slew of issues with the engine's performance. Suffice to say, it might hamper your ability to drive safely and successfully on the road.

Top 5 Bad ECU Symptoms of BMW Greensboro

Fortunately, there are certain warning signs that you may check for to see whether your engine control unit is failing.

Check Engine Light:

The "Check Engine" warning light comes on when the engine control unit detects issues with its electrical components, circuits, or sensors. To determine if your car is having problems, look for specific trouble codes on its computing system.

Engine Misfires or Stalls:

The presence of a warning light might indicate an issue with the engine. The sequence of engine misfires and stalls will be unpredictable, making it difficult to determine the exact source of the engine problem. Often, this is due to a malfunctioning engine control module providing incorrect information to the engine. Opt for BMW Greensboro service to keep your engine up and running.

Bad Gas Mileage:

A faulty ECM might cause your vehicle to consume more gasoline than it requires. A poor air-fuel ratio is the source of the problem. If you have an ECM, you'll need to set aside extra money each month for fuel. You're not going to help the environment either.

Poor Engine Performance:

A malfunctioning ECM might result in insufficient fuel being supplied to the combustion chamber. This implies that when you press the gas pedal, your vehicle will not speed up as quickly as it formerly did. It could even vibrate and rattle a little, especially if you're driving around the treacherous terrain or going up the steep hills.

Car Won’t Start:

Are you struggling to start up your engine? Is your engine control unit a complete failure? Only a trained auto mechanic can tell if this symptom has to do with a malfunctioning engine. There might be other causes for your engine's failure to start.

What are the trouble signs? 


Following are the trouble signs that should catch the eye: 


  • Not enough tread depth- The treads are responsible for maintaining the friction with the road. It prevents the car from slipping on water or snow. If you notice that there is not enough tread then it might be a good idea to replace the tires. 
  • Presence of too many cracks- Worn out tire will start showing plenty of cracks all around. They start small on the side walls which seem to increase when one drives it more. With driving and time the small cracks gets stretched and begins spreading across the tires. As the tracks deepen it can rip out the tires at some point. Before that happens it is easy to get them replaced. 
  • Repeated punctures- Notice whether the frequency of punctures have increased. If they have then the tires must have worn out. When the tires get old the rubber tread starts to wear out. This gives easy passage to sharp objects that puts a dent in the tires. Frequent punctures are a sign that is time for tire replacement.

How Do You Check The Transmission Fluid of VW

 Learning how to check your transmission fluid isn’t challenging. In the hands of experts, it can be done in a few minutes. Here’s what you need to do:


  • Start by turning the car on. You can expect an accurate read on your transmission fluid only when then transmission gets warm. 
  • Detect the transmission fluid dipstick. It could be found near the oil dipstick, so you should not have any trouble. If you encounter difficulties, just take the help of your nearest VW Service Greensboro NC center. 
  • Undo the dipstick and use your fingers to inspect the consistency of the fluid. It should be pink to light red in tone. If you notice any changes in color, you need to go for a change. Even if the fluid gives off a burnt smell, it’s a red flag. 
  • If you notice any such issues, it’s time to check your transmission fluid level. Wipe off the dipstick with a rag and reinsert it. Then remove it once more. Check if it’s below the “Full” line. If so, you need to add more. 
  • Carefully, use a funnel to restore transmission fluid to the proper level. Don’t rush. Be sure to stop often when adding a fluid and check where you’re at.

What’s New for 2021:

While it sets its own identity in the Volkswagen brand, it is also the first in the series of all-electric models that will speadhead ID sub-brand in the coming days. 

Engine, Transmission, and Performance:

While all-wheel drive models will eventually join the lineup, the single-motor rear wheel drive models will be the first to launch. The rear-mounted motor delivers an impressive performance at 201 horsepower, whereas the dual motor all-wheel drive will crank up a stout 302. The advanced braking system helps regain energy when slowing the vehicle, and the ID.4 is capable of towing up to 2700 pounds. 


Interior, Comfort, Cargo:

The interior looks less lound than the ID, With retractable steering wheel and sliding rear doors, the ID.4 offers an array of high tech features, ambient lighting, and generous cargo space. The world inside is calm and clutter free. The 1st Edition model features accelerator and brake pedals with cheeky play and pause symbols. Cloth seats are standard; but you can have faux-leather upholstery along with 12-way power adjustable front seats with massage and memory functionality by opting for the optional statement package. 

Infotainment and Connectivity:

The ID.4  comes standard with a 10.0-inch infotainment touchscreen that can be upgraded to a large 12.0-inch display with the optional Statement package.  Navigation is standard with both displays.  The popular smartphone connectivity is available with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to.All ID.4 models feature a 3-inch reconfigurable digital gauge display and voice recognition capability, notes expert from Volkswagen Repair Greensboro NC.

When the GLA was introduced in 2014, it was a mere mildly lifted hatchback. Now for the second generation, the GLA is an SUV in much more than name only.

Mercedes-Benz's 2021 GLA is now much taller and wider than the outgoing model. However, it's also 0.6 inches shorter due to the shorter front and rear overhangs, note Mercedes-Benz Repair Greensboro NC expert.

The shape almost remains the same. Calling it a wagon with a subtlety sloping roof and the raked rear end won't be unjust. The changes culminate into a more convincing SUV shape, with the gorgeous fitting with Mercedes' SUV design language.

Mercedes-Benz Repair Greensboro NC 
You will have a fundamentally similar turbocharged 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ine developing 221 hp, 13 more than before, and 258 lb-ft torque under the hood. The inline-four features adjustable valve timing and valve lift on the intake side and uses quick fuel injectors, providing enough fuel for the additional needed air.

The 2.0 liter is a beefy motor, and it delivers all the 258 lb-ft of torque throughout the rev range. Moreover, body control is above average for such an SUV. It takes advantage of a strut front and multilink independent suspension. The feel is much more akin to the CLA, says Mercedes Benz Service expert, than a typical SUV.
